2.4.2 Output Rate
The default return rate of the module is 10Hz, the highest return rate supports
200Hz.
10Hz refers to the return of 10 data packets in 1S. 1 data packet is 33 bytes by
default.
Note: If there are more backhaul contents and the communication baud rate is
lower, it may not be possible to transmit so much data. Then the module will
automatically reduce the frequency and output at the maximum allowable
output rate. To put it simply, if the return rate is high, the baud rate should also
be set higher, generally 115200.
